How can I keep my Tall Fescue lawn healthy during summer without wasting water?

Modern Wi-Fi ET-based weather sensing irrigation is the standard for efficiency. This system automatically adjusts watering schedules based on real-time evapotranspiration data, preventing overwatering. For Okolona's silt loam, it ensures deep, infrequent watering that promotes deeper root systems in Tall Fescue. This method aligns perfectly with Louisville MSD's conservation recommendations, keeping your lawn resilient while staying well within municipal water use guidelines.

What invasive species should I watch for, and how do I remove them safely?

In Okolona, watch for invasive plants like Japanese Knotweed, Wintercreeper, and Callery Pear. Manual removal or targeted, professional-grade herbicide application during active growth phases is most effective. All treatment plans must be designed to prevent any illicit discharge into the storm sewer, strictly adhering to MSD Clean Water Standards. Proper disposal of plant material is also crucial to prevent re-establishment.

Water pools in my yard after heavy rain. What's the best long-term solution?

Pooling is often due to Okolona's clay-heavy subsoil and moderate runoff characteristics. The primary solution is improving subsurface drainage through techniques like French drains or dry creek beds. For new hardscapes, using permeable concrete pavers instead of solid concrete can significantly reduce surface runoff. These systems manage stormwater on-site, which is a key requirement for meeting Louisville Metro Planning & Design Services' updated runoff and permeability standards.

I'm tired of weekly mowing. Are there lower-maintenance, attractive alternatives to grass?

Transitioning to a xeriscape or native planting bed dramatically reduces maintenance. Species like Purple Coneflower, Wild Bergamot, Butterfly Milkweed, and Little Bluestem are adapted to Zone 7a and require no irrigation once established. This approach eliminates weekly mowing and gas-powered trimming, keeping you ahead of evolving noise ordinances. It also creates a high-value habitat that supports local pollinator biodiversity, a key landscape standard for 2026.

Our yard's soil seems heavy and compacted. Is this normal for Okolona homes built in the 1970s?

Yes, this is a common legacy soil condition. Homes built around 1973, typical for Okolona, have soil profiles over 50 years old where original topsoil was often stripped. The underlying silt loam becomes compacted from decades of foot traffic and machinery, reducing permeability. This compaction impedes water percolation and root growth, which is why core aeration and incorporating 2-3 inches of composted organic matter are critical first steps to rebuild soil structure and biology.

Are concrete pavers a better choice than wood for a new patio?

Concrete pavers offer superior longevity and lower lifetime maintenance compared to wood, which rots and requires regular sealing. Pavers provide a stable, non-combustible surface, an important consideration for maintaining defensible space in line with our moderate Fire Wise rating. Their modular design also allows for easy repair and greater permeability when installed correctly, making them a resilient and practical choice for Okolona's climate.

Do I need a permit to regrade my backyard, and who is qualified to do the work?

Yes, significant grading on a 0.22-acre lot typically requires a permit from Louisville Metro Planning & Design Services to ensure proper stormwater management. The design and oversight of such earthwork should be performed by or under the direction of a professional licensed by the Kentucky Board of Landscape Architects. This ensures the work meets structural and environmental codes, protects your property value, and avoids costly violations related to drainage and runoff.
